I walked into my oldest daughter's school one day and noticed some of the girls from her group staring at me. My daughter ran to me and gave me a big hug, one of the little things I look foward to during the day. She went to grab her things, when I noticed the girls asking her questions and looking back at me. My daughter called me over and it began: "Are you really her mom?" "You look so young!" "You always dress nice, my mom doesn't look like you." I didn't know what to say. I smiled and said "Yeah, I'm her mom. Thank you"

Walking to get my other two little  ones I couldn't help but think is this the result of mothers having children? Have we lost a sense of style? We put down all the fashion magazines and picked up pregnancy and parenting magazines instead. That was me for a long time after my oldest was born. I spent my time wearing jeans and tee shirts that made it easy to breastfeed. Ugh, and those bras were a killer. I would like to think that we all love to feel beautiful, and look beautiful too.

At first I was alright with it; lazy days and no sleep. But after being out with my daughter, catching a glimpse of myself in a store front window I was not happy with what I saw. What happened to the cool fashionable person I was before having her? Did I loose myself as an individual? Over a long talk with a fellow mom, she recommended that I do things slowly. I started wearing makeup and starting slowly on building my new style as a mom and as a person. Simple tees, distressed jeans, a cute neakless, scarf and either converses or flats. Once I started feeling more like myself I added more to my style, blazers, cute jackets and shoes that were cute and I could run after kids with.
